    Aadhaar: Most insurers awaiting IRDAI guidance after Supreme Court ruling

    Source: The Hindu BusinessLine Sep 29, 2018

    A majority of private insurers — life, general and standalone health — have decided to wait for IRDAI’s guidance on the implementation of the Supreme Court’s recent Aadhaar ruling as regards the insurance industry.

    This is even as several top players including HDFC Life have stopped making submission of Aadhaar mandatory for new customers.

    “IRDAI has, through its AML Master Circular, provided a list of acceptable Officially Valid Documents, which we were accepting even before the Supreme Court’s order and shall continue doing so,” an HDFC Life spokesperson told BusinessLine .
